Do you have a way to know which files have the longest chains? I have a suspiscion that the ChangeLog* files are among them, not only because they are, almost without exception, only modified by prepending text to the previous version (and a fairly small amount compared to the size of the file), and therefore the diff is simple (a single hunk) so that the limit on chain depth is probably what causes a new copy to be created. Besides that these files grow quite large and become some of the largest files in the tree, and at least one of them is changed for every commit. This leads again to many versions of fairly large files. If this guess is right, this implies that most of the size gains from longer chains comes from having less copies of the ChangeLog* files. From a performance point of view, it is rather favourable since the differences are simple. This would also explain why the window parameter has little effect. Regards, Gabriel
